Student-Entrepreneur : The New Way of Employment in China.Comments Offina is one of the most populated country in the world with almost 2 billion inhabitants. Each year, more than 7 million of students are gratuated and only 1/3 find a job. There is a dizzy problem of employment. The employment market is more and more stuggled. That’s why, a lot of student prefered to build their own business. Entrepreneurship is becoming a solution to reduce the stress of all this students.
#gallery-1 {margin: auto;}#gallery-1 .gallery-item {float: left;margin-top: 10px;text-align: center;width: 33%;}#gallery-1 img {border: 2px solid #cfcfcf;}#gallery-1 .gallery-caption {margin-left: 0;}
BE A STUDENT IN CHINA
The quality of the degrees in China is know all over the world. In China, the number of graduated students growth, they have very good degrees and skills to be very performant on the employment market. However, it’s not the case. The growing of high level degrees didn’t create more qulaified employments. Lot of students have to reduce their employment requirements because they don’t find a job. Where is the promise did by univertsities to students? In few years, the number of students having a non qualified job doubled. A huge problem that concern not only students but every chinese people.
ENTREPRENEURSHIP? THE NEW SOLUTION?
Entrepreneurship is becoming the solution in China. Lot of students prefer create their own company than be unemployed or have a non qualified job. The government and universities encourage this practice and help students in their business creations.
Most of the start-ups are openend in Zhuhai. It’s the city which has the most importante number of start-ups in China with around 2800 new start-ups every year. This city has a high number of start-ups because there are a lot of very good universities, it’s on of the most rich city of China and its geographic situation is perfect (close to Macao and in front of HongKong and Shenzhen).
Besides, government encourage the students to build their own business by reducing the companies’s tax.
More and more Schools & university encourage their Student to Launch companies in China, and specially in Shanghai.
HELP FOR THE STUDENT-ENTREPRENEURS
But, create a start-ups it’s not so easy. Today in China, it’s becoming the new way but teachers are a bit affraid about all this students who want to create their business. Create a business it’s easy but it’s hard to keep it open.
Lot of teachers and school directors warn students about risks to create your own business.
For Universities it’s a good economic opportunity that’s why they help students.
To reduce this lack of knowleadges of business creation, universities and governement work together to help the students. The governement reduce the company tax during the first 3 years, if they are 3 new graduated students in the company, they can request for an annual help of 481$ USD and governement ask them to follow an education in university to know more about the basic-skills to open your start-ups.
One amazing thing, in a country where sucess, ranking and have a good job to make money are very important, parents encourage their kids when they decided to enter in this perious adventure. Parents are often the first investors.
2 EXAMPLES OF CHINESE YOUNG ENTREPRENEURS
Cai Yutie, is 23 year old. He was student in Journalism in Zhuhai University. With a friend, they decided to open a shop in Zhuhai which offers women clothes and accessories. Their shop GreatMe is quickly becoming popular because it’s modern, when you enter in the shop, light is perfect and music trendy. For the moment, they don’t make a lot of money but it paid bills and rent.
For Cai Yutie, chinese student prefer create their own business because they are often bored in the traditionnal system which no longer reply to their expectations. That’s why they prefer create a start-ups, there are more free and can be very creative and express themselves. The chinese society is see by this students as a drag to their ambitions.
Wen Zibin is an other student-entrepreneur graduated from the Shenzhen University. This 22 year old man started by working in a company thanks to his parents relationships. But he quickly feel bored because the job is less qualified that he can do and not very creative. With two others friends, they also decided to open a shop : Momo, a cake shop. Their cakes are very appreciated by young people. They decided to followed a new education in pastry to develop their business and attract new consumers.
Wen say that it’s not easy to keep open his shop. Sometimes he wants to give up because you have bills, not a lot of customers, administration issues, you feel stangled. But each time, they found a solution to solve their problem. It encouraged them to keep going.
The job market in China is a market arrived at maturation and now saturated. China each year has more and more young people graduated unemployed. This young people often leave because they are very stress to don’t find a job. They moved abroad. But, a large part of them try to stay in their country and used their skills to develop their own business. The entrepreneurship is encourage by governement because its a solution to their problem of unemployment and students feel better. So everybody is happy.

As of December 2015, WeChat reached over 650 million active users (more than 88% of those users are chinese).
Its direct competitors, Skype, Whatsapp, Viber and Line reach just over 300 million, 800 million, 100 million and 560 million.
Worldwide, WeChat ranks in the top 2 most popular social networking-messaging applications, based solely on active users.
From a China perspective, WeChat is by far the single most popular application.
– Unlike WhatsApp, Wechat is not just a mobile phone messaging application, it also out-competes RenRen (the equivalent of Facebook in China) by having more active users.
– Unlike WhatsApp, WeChat is also China’s default messaging service on PCs and Tablets. Knowing that CTRs are higher on PCs and Tablets, this aspect brings greater visibility and higher CTRs for advertisers.
– It is also the default video chat app in the way that Skype is to users within the United States.
WeChat is truly the dominant social media in China.
Considering non-Chinese users only, WeChat’s total active users will not be representative of its popularity in English speaking markets such as USA, Canada, Australia etc.
Like Whatsapp, if the user were to lose their phone or change their number, they would be able to transfer all their contacts and messages onto a new phone. WeChat shares all the important features of Whatsapp such as Group Chat, Text Chat, Voice Chat, Web Chat, sending photos and videos and sharing location.
Thus, it combines the advantages of social networking offered by Facebook, the mobile phone usability of WhatsApp and video messaging popularity of Skype all in one single platform.
If you consider to engage the Chinese market from a long-term business standpoint, wechat is a MUST.
WeChat offers greater usability and several features which outdo its current competition.
WeChat Users, what you need to know
Looking at the demographics of Wechat users in China, we realize WeChat looks like Facebook in United States in the mid-2000s, meaning
it’s primarily used by youth and trendy segments in major cities of China.
Age: Only 15% of WeChat users are aged over 35, and of these, Chinese natives constitute an even lesser percentage. Therefore, if your product/service targets elder or middle aged native Chinese population, RenRen is probably a better solution.
Gender: female users represent under 35% of wechat users.

Baidu invest in xPerceptionComments OffIncluding xPerception is the new step to strengthen the power of Chinese giant Baidu
Baidu, the administrator of China’s prevailing on the web index, has gotten US start-up xPerception, established by previous specialists from Software, web and PC benefits firm Magic Leap, as it proceeds in its journey to pull in the best ability in Silicon Valley.
xPerception, which makes Vision observation Software and equipment with applications in mechanical autonomy and virtual reality, will keep on developing their center Technology under Baidu’s exploration unit, the Chinese firm said in an announcement on Thursday.
Baidu is focusing on outside work force and Technology as a component of a more extensive drive to refocus organization assets on creating computerized reasoning abilities.
Incomes from the company’s center hunt unit got hammered a year ago when the Chinese government fixed online promotion directions, separating a lump of existing sponsors with new qualification prerequisites. The declaration comes as other Chinese Tech firms battle with administrative pushback on acquisitions in the U.S. showcase.
Baidu Research & Development
Established in Mountain View, California, in 2016 by previous Magic Leap engineers Bao Yingze and Chen Mingyu, xPerception will have its center group joining Baidu Research and proceeding to build up the organization’s center Technology – visual inertial synchronous localization and mapping.
The span of the arrangement is obscure, and Baidu declined to remark past a statement. The takeover is the most recent in a series of speculations gone for fortifying Baidu’s initiative in computerized reasoning.
Not long ago, it contracted previous Microsoft official Lu Qi, a main AI researcher, as its head-working officer. The firm additionally procured Beijing start-up Raven Tech, which represents considerable authority in voice-controlled AI, and coordinated its group into its brilliant home gadgets business.
Baidu CEO
Baidu CEO Robin Li has encouraged the Chinese government to issue more green cards so that Chinese Technology organizations can pull in more gifted Silicon Valley engineers.
The organization has been concentrating on AI to recover its footing after the Chinese government’s more tightly web based publicizing directions hosed its center web index business.
The xPerception securing is relied upon to additionally fortify the utilization of Baidu’s visual observation Technology in “key undertakings like expanded reality and self-governing driving, quickening the improvement of AI-based items”, the organization said.
“The arrangement of AI and machine learning could be problematic to plans of action in the way that the presentation of Smartphone was. Also, that implies substantial organizations must contribute to keep up market position,” said Krik Boodry, an investigator at New Street Research.
AI-controlled
Baidu is contending in AI-controlled items, for example, self-sufficient driving with any semblance of Alphabet and Uber Technologies and top ability is viewed as the most pressing asset to pick up the high ground in the war zone.
Robin Li Yanhong, Baidu’s CEO, has even asked the Chinese government to issue more green cards so that Chinese Technology organizations can draw in more gifted Beijing Silicon Valley engineers, who might be put off by US President Donald Trump’s prohibitive movement arrangements.
The organization is setting up a moment innovative work office in the region, including 150 representatives.
In late March, it commenced its first abroad grounds enrollment battle, going to top US examine colleges, for example, Carnegie Mellon, Berkeley and Stanford to lift its AI ability pool.
Chinese Online Property Market Appears Set For Lengthy DownturnComments OffChina’s online property market industry appears set for a prolonged downturn that will last far into 2017 and potentially beyond, according to analysts who say government policies intended to steady the housing sector have depressed sales and have had the expected effect of reducing demand for the online property services.
The projection of an extended downturn in the online property sector follows years of both growth and contraction, and the volatility in the market is one of the reasons that the government is imposing strict rules to avoid a housing market crash. If China were to experience a housing market bubble that burst, it would create significantly greater economic problems affecting more sectors than a narrower decline affecting just the property market.
The declining Chinese property market “is entering a long winter for at least six months.
According to a report released this week by economic analysts Alvin Jiang and Alan Hellawell from Deutsche Bank, the declining Chinese property market “is entering a long winter for at least six months.”
The South China Morning Post notes that the analysts believe that this downturn will last through to end of 2017, which could mean it lasts even longer — potentially into 2018. The analysts say that the decrease in the market can be directly connected to government policies that aim to avoid a housing market crash by imposing strict requirements on several important factors such as managing property prices and limiting transactions. [1]
In their report, the analysts said, “Both the online property transaction business and the related listing business are suffering from the cold property market. Continuing strict policies have frozen transactions and hurt the desire of property agents to spend,” which has led to major drops in property transactions. For example, the report says that the volume of property transactions in China’s top 10 cities dropped 25 percent in October.
The Chinese Online Property portals
Given the downturn, the analysts decided to downgrade their rating of the online property portal sales SouFun to “sell,” citing “continuing weakness” in the sector as well as the company’s apparent “scaling down” of operations. The analysts also downgrade 58.com — another online property sales portal — to “hold” rather than “buy” for similar reasons, because it “reflect[s] our concern on the continuing weakness in the property segment.”
However, a blog post on Barron’s Asia notes that the analysts’ report appears to be late in coming, because the property market was already experiencing a freeze before the release of the findings. [2]
“Isn’t Deutsche a bit too late to the game?” asked the blog post, which noted that SouFun had already dropped 60 percent in value and 58.com had experienced a similar 50 percent decrease this year.
The conclusions on the downturn in the market are in contrast to news reports earlier this year which said that SouFun was among several online property companies enjoying a rebound of growth.
For example, Bloomberg Technology reported as recently as March this year that due to a combination of government stimulus funding and a growth in the property market SouFun recovered 25 percent on the Bloomberg China-U.S. Equity Index compared to February this year. [3]
The Deutsche Bank analysis underscores the unpredictability and volatility of the housing market, and suggests that online property companies might need to rethink their strategies for 2017.
